Common Issues with Patio Doors
Patio doors can come across several issues over the years, which might depend upon their product, type (Local Sliding Door Installers or hinged), and installation. Below is a table describing the most frequent issues faced by patio door owners.

| Common Issues | Description | Possible Causes |
|---|---|---|
| Misalignment | Door is tough to open/close or does not sit flush | Shifting structure or worn rollers |
| Harmed weather condition stripping | Drafts or water leakages around the edges | Wear and tear, physical damage |
| Broken glass | Cracks or shatters in the glass | Impact, climate condition |
| Malfunctioning locks | Problem locking/unlocking the door | Rust, dirt build-up or broken elements |
| Sticking door | Door becomes stuck during operation | Dirt accumulation, deformed frame or tracks |
| Weakened frame | Noticeable damage or decomposing in the door frame | Wetness exposure, poor-quality materials |
Understanding these problems can help house owners detect problems faster and take required actions before they intensify.
DIY Repairs for Common Problems
While some patio door problems may need professional intervention, numerous repairs can be carried out by house owners with standard tools. Here are some typical problems and DIY solutions:
1. Misalignment
Option: Adjusting the Rollers
- Tools Needed: Screwdriver, adjustable wrench
- Actions:
- Locate the roller modification screws at the bottom of the door.
- Use the screwdriver or adjustable wrench to raise or reduce the door by turning the screws clockwise or counterclockwise.

2. Damaged Weather Stripping
Option: Replacement
- Tools Needed: Utility knife, adhesive, brand-new weather condition removing
- Actions:
- Remove the old weather stripping utilizing the energy knife.
- Clean the location to remove any adhesive residues.
- Procedure and cut the new weather stripping to size.
- Apply the adhesive and press the new weather condition stripping into location.
3. Broken Glass
Option: Glass Replacement
- Tools Needed: Safety gloves, putty knife, replacement glass, caulk
- Actions:
- Carefully remove the damaged glass and clean the frame.
- Fit the brand-new glass into the frame.
- Apply caulk around the edges to seal it.
- Enable it to dry as per the instructions offered on the caulk.
4. Faulty Locks
Option: Clean or Replace Lock
- Tools Needed: Lubricant, screwdriver
- Actions:
- Apply lubricant to the lock system.
- If the locking mechanism stays malfunctioning, eliminate the lock with a screwdriver.
- Replace it with a brand-new lock, following maker guidelines.
5. Sticking Door
Solution: Clean Tracks and Realign
- Tools Needed: Vacuum, soap and water, lubricant
- Steps:
- Clean the tracks thoroughly to eliminate dirt and particles.
- Check the positioning and make changes as needed.
- Use a lightweight lube to guarantee smooth operation.
6. Deteriorated Frame
Option: Repair or Replace Portions
- Tools Needed: Wood filler, paint, saw (if needed)
- Steps:
- Assess the level of the damage to identify if repair is possible.
- Fill any gaps with wood filler and sand it smooth.
- Paint or stain the fixed area to match the surrounding frame.
When to Call a Professional
Particular repair work may require customized understanding, tools, or authorizations, such as:
- Structural damage to the structure.
- Substantial locksmith professional services.
- Major glass replacement or glazing services.
- Decomposed wood that impacts the structural integrity.
If the repair surpasses your comfort level or tools, it's best to contact a professional to ensure security and proper craftsmanship.
Frequently Asked Questions About Patio Door Repair
1. Just how much does it cost to repair a patio door?
Repair costs can vary commonly based on the issue, products, and professional repair charges. Basic repairs like replacing weather condition stripping may cost between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150, while replacing glass or complex lock systems can reach ₤ 300 or more.
2. Can I replace simply one part of the door?
Yes, lots of components of patio doors can be replaced individually, consisting of locks, rollers, and weather condition stripping.
3. How can I avoid future issues with my patio door?
Regular maintenance, such as cleaning tracks, lubricating mechanisms, and inspecting for wear, can help extend the life of your Patio Door Security door.
4. How do I understand if I need to replace my patio door rather than repair it?
Indications consist of comprehensive damage, such as warping, scrubby frames, or multiple concerns occurring all at once. A professional evaluation can assist determine if replacement is required.
